Available to read online here, the February-March 2026 issue is the first with new editor Simon Harris onboard and features analysis of the big topics in fleet management, offering advice and guidance on how you can run your fleet more efficiently. Contributors include Ezoo, Ogilvie Fleet, the BVRLA, IFM and Venson.

We’ve been behind the wheel of the latest Kia electric vehicles, including the Sportage-sized EV5 and the van-based PV5 Passenger MPV, as well as the new BYD Sealion 5 hybrid.

We welcome a new, regular column from the anonymous diary of a fleet manager, plus there’s highlights of the Brussels Motor Show, and we take a closer look at the recently unveiled Volvo EX60.

KGM’s Charlie Jones answers our ‘Fleet 15’ questions, we have a supplier story from Quartix as it marks 25 years in business, and we have Fleet Fundamentals with the support of DKV Mobility on fuel cards, and Geotab on fleet safety.

Van Fleet World has tyres in the spotlight, investigating the latest developments for commercial vehicles, plus a focus on cybersecurity and how businesses can minimise the risks
